THE INCIDENCE AND OUTCOME OF FEBRILE NEUTROPENIA IN DIFFERENT CHEMOTHERAPY REGIMENS FOR CANCER PATIENTS IN BELGIUM

OBJECTIVES: The incidence of febrile neutropenia (FN) depends on the cancer type and the chemotherapy regimen used. In Belgium, reimbursement of granulocyte-colony stimulating factors (G-CSF) in primary prophylaxis against FN is limited to 4 indications. This study aimed to provide real-life information on the incidence and impact of FN in chemotherapy-cancer combinations excluded from G-CSF primary prophylaxis reimbursement. METHODS: Based on ICD-9 code and drug name all chemotherapy-cancer combinations with at least one patient having an ICD-9 code corresponding to neutropenia (288.0) and/or fever (780.6) and where G-CSF primary prophylaxis was not reimbursed, were retrieved from the IMS Hospital Disease database for the period 2005-2008. This database includes longitudinal (per calendar year) information on diagnoses and drugs prescribed in about 34% of all Belgian hospital beds. Incidence of FN (cases of FN with chemo-cancer combination divided by total number of patients with this chemo-cancer combination), mortality in patients with and without FN and impact of FN on subsequent chemotherapy treatment decisions were assessed. RESULTS: Among the 25,544 patients at risk, 3,191 (13%) had at least one FN episode. Highest incidence rates were found in combinations of cisplatin-containing regimens with head and neck (71/287, 25%), stomach (24/110, 22%) and esophagus (36/202, 18%) cancers, lung cancers treated with cisplatin-etoposide (52/292, 18%) or carboplatin-etoposide (102/659, 16%) regimen and multiple myeloma treated with doxorubicin-vincristine regimen (26/152, 17%). Overall, 50% of first FN episodes occurred during cycle 1. Of the 3191 FN patients 11% died, 24% switched chemotherapy regimen and 22% stopped treatment during the cycle with FN. FN occurred subsequently in 27% of 1367 patients continuing the same regimen. CONCLUSIONS: This study suggests clinically significant FN-incidence is associated with chemotherapy regimens where G-CSF primary prophylaxis is not reimbursed in Belgium, which may lead to negative outcomes in terms of mortality and treatment disruption.
